Welcome to the Quillgate platform team. Every tenant on Quillgate is assigned a per-tenant rate quota, enforced at the edge by the Tollbooth service. Quotas are defined in tenants.yaml and reviewed quarterly; never raise a quota manually without an approved change ticket, as overrides bypass billing reconciliation. If a tenant reports throttling, verify their tier in the Ledgerview console first. For quota adjustment requests, reach out to the capacity desk at the address below.

pager mailbox: silael.sorwyn.tamius@zemvarsys.corp

## Introduce per-tenant rate quotas in the Orvane gateway

For the release manager: this change replaces our global throttle with per-tenant quotas, resolved at request time from the tenant registry and cached for sixty seconds. Tenants without an explicit quota inherit the tier default; overage returns a retryable status with a hint header. Rollout is gated behind a flag, defaulting off, and the old throttle remains as a backstop until two clean release cycles pass.

The initial tier defaults we intend to ship are listed below.

limits module of taguf-hafog:
WEIGHTS = {
    "wenox": 690,
    "wenok": 782,
    "kelax": 41,
    "holox": 338,
    "quenir": 39,
}

Ticket #— Floor 9 Opening Prep, Brindlemoor House

Hi facilities folks, Floor 9 opens to staff next Monday and we need a few things squared away before then. Lift access is live, but the two side doors by the kitchenette are still on the old lock config — please reprogram them before Friday. Also, signage for the quiet rooms hasn't arrived, so pop up the temporary printed ones for now. Until the badge readers sync, the interim door code for Floor 9 is below.

door code, bajop-bajog: bdg-DSWAC-43621

// CATALOG_CACHE_TTL_SECONDS controls how long Shelfwright keeps
// product-catalog entries before forced invalidation. Release manager:
// do not raise this above 900 without coordinating with the pricing
// team, since stale entries caused the Brindlemart discount incident.
// Any change here must ship in its own release so rollback is clean,
// and the invalidation sweep must be re-verified against the build
// whose token appears below.

trace token, fafog-kageg: htk4_98e6